23 May 2012, 11:59 am by Debra A. McCurdy
As a result, hospitals paid under the IPPS may incur a payment penalty if a skilled nursing facility, long-term acute care hospital, inpatient rehabilitation facility or other post-acute care provider transfers a patient or resident back to the hospital for additional inpatient services. 14 Jan 2015, 6:28 am by Debra A. McCurdy
On December 31, 2014, the IRS published final regulations providing guidance on the community health needs assessment and financial assistance policy requirements for charitable hospitals under the ACA. [read post]
28 Aug 2013, 6:54 pm
One common type of Medicare billing fraud is called upcoding, which involves a medical provider billing for a more costly procedure or diagnosis than what was actually provided. [read post]
